Ultrashort pulse (USP) lasers are increasingly used for industrial manufacturing, with key application spaces including glass processing, metal engraving, and medical device manufacturing. At the infrared (IR) wavelength of ~1 µm, the short pulse duration enables high quality processing with low heat effects compared to longer nanosecond and microsecond pulse widths, resulting in minimal melting and burrs when processing metals and reduced chipping and cracking when processing glass. In many cases, however, a shorter ultraviolet (UV) wavelength introduces additional benefits. The shorter wavelength enables smaller focus spot sizes and a longer processing depth of field.
